Pavers Hardscaping in Fairfield County, CT

Pavers hardscaping services encompass the installation and design of durable, attractive surfaces using interlocking pavers, concrete, or stone materials. These services are commonly requested for projects such as patios, walkways, driveways, and outdoor seating areas. Homeowners often seek to enhance the aesthetic appeal of their outdoor spaces while creating functional areas that withstand regular use and weather conditions. Understanding the different types of pavers, the layout options, and the overall maintenance requirements can help property owners make informed decisions before initiating a project.

Before requesting pavers hardscaping services, property owners should consider the scope of the project, including the size and layout of the area, as well as the style and material preferences. It’s helpful to evaluate existing landscape features and think about how the new hardscape will integrate with the overall property design. Additionally, understanding the base preparation needed for proper installation and the potential long-term upkeep can ensure the selected materials and design choices align with the property's needs and aesthetic goals.

FAQ

Pavers Hardscaping Questions

What are pavers used for in hardscaping? Pavers are commonly used for patios, walkways, driveways, and outdoor seating areas, providing durable and attractive surfaces.

How long do paver installations typically last? Properly installed pavers can last for decades with minimal maintenance, maintaining their appearance and functionality over time.

Are pavers suitable for different types of outdoor spaces? Yes, pavers are versatile and can be used in a variety of outdoor projects, including gardens, pool decks, and outdoor kitchens.

What should property owners consider before installing pavers? It's important to evaluate the site’s drainage, soil stability, and design preferences to ensure a successful paver installation.
